2012-03-17 6 views
0

私は複数のタブを持つtabControlコントロールを持っています。各タブごとに、上から下にコントロールを配置するタブインデックスを追加しています。tabControlのタブインデックス

しかし、プログラム中にタブをクリックすると、プログラムがコントロールからコントロールに移動する順序は、指定した順序ではありません。

これはtabControlと関係がありますか?

私は各コントロールに "tabIndex"プロパティを使用しています。

編集:私はこの機能については知りませんでした申し訳ありませんが、ここではそれが表示するものである:

http://s7.postimage.org/m9burkbx5/Tab_Order.jpg

赤い矢印はタブが行うフローです。

+1

View-> TabOrderメニュー項目を使用する際の問題点は何ですか? – Steve

+0

特別請求は特別な証拠を必要とします。表示+タブスクリーンショットを注文して投稿します。 –

+0

@ Hans彼は彼が各コントロールのtabIndexプロパティを直接使用していると思いますが、このプロパティはコンテナコントロールに関連しているので混乱します。 – Steve

答えて

1

TabOrderツールをアクティブにして、各コンテナコントロール(グループボックスなど)を最初にクリックし、グループボックス内のコントロールの順序が間違っている場合は、希望の順番で各コントロールをクリックします。
クリック数に応じて数値が表示されます。場合によっては間違った順序でクリックすることがあります。この場合、TabOrderツールを閉じてからもう一度やり直してください。